Gift Cards – Rumored Death Greatly Exaggerated

Despite survey results to the contrary and concerns of their viability in times of economic uncertainty, Internet searches for gift cards continue to surge this holiday season . If we look at the following chart of search term volume on “gift cards” we see that while we are experiencing a slight decrease over the previous year (this week’s data, update expected Monday, will provide insight into the anticipated peek for searches), searches are far from the 51% decrease reported by shoppers in the above survey.

Since our search behavior shows increased numbers of words per query (as we become more sophisticated in our queries) we should also examine the breadth of our “gift card” searches.

Breadth has increased over the previous holiday season, with top gift card searches including; Visa, American Express, iTunes and WalMart. Analysis of the full list of “gift card” variations reveals that discount stores are the clear winners this year, but here’s the surprise, when we compare the top gift card searches this year compared to last year, the second hand market via Craigslist appears to be flourishing.

A quick search for “gift cards” on Craigslist in various markets reveals several listings with sellers discounting cards as much as 20% off their face value.
